package com.itextpdf.kernel.font;
import com.itextpdf.test.ExtendedITextTest;
import org.junit.jupiter.api.Assertions;
import org.junit.jupiter.api.Test;
import org.junit.jupiter.api.Tag;
@Tag("UnitTest")
public class Type3FontTest extends ExtendedITextTest {
@Test
public void addGlyphTest() {
Type3Font font = new Type3Font(false);
font.addGlyph(1, 1, 600, null, null);
Assertions.assertEquals(1, font.getNumberOfGlyphs());
}
@Test
public void addGlyphsWithDifferentUnicodeTest() {
Type3Font font = new Type3Font(false);
font.addGlyph(1, 1, 600, null, null);
font.addGlyph(2, 2, 600, null, null);
Assertions.assertEquals(2, font.getNumberOfGlyphs());
Assertions.assertEquals(1, font.getGlyphByCode(1).getUnicode());
Assertions.assertEquals(2, font.getGlyphByCode(2).getUnicode());
}
@Test
public void addGlyphsWithDifferentCodesTest() {
Type3Font font = new Type3Font(false);
font.addGlyph(1, -1, 600, null, null);
font.addGlyph(2, -1, 700, null, null);
Assertions.assertEquals(2, font.getNumberOfGlyphs());
Assertions.assertEquals(600, font.getGlyphByCode(1).getWidth());
Assertions.assertEquals(700, font.getGlyphByCode(2).getWidth());
}
@Test
public void replaceGlyphsWithSameUnicodeTest() {
Type3Font font = new Type3Font(false);
font.addGlyph(1, 1, 600, null, null);
font.addGlyph(2, 1, 600, null, null);
Assertions.assertEquals(1, font.getNumberOfGlyphs());
Assertions.assertEquals(2, font.getGlyph(1).getCode());
}
@Test
public void replaceGlyphWithSameCodeTest() {
Type3Font font = new Type3Font(false);
font.addGlyph(1, -1, 600, null, null);
font.addGlyph(1, -1, 700, null, null);
Assertions.assertEquals(1, font.getNumberOfGlyphs());
Assertions.assertEquals(700, font.getGlyphByCode(1).getWidth());
}
@Test
public void notAddGlyphWithSameCodeEmptyUnicodeFirstTest() {
Type3Font font = new Type3Font(false);
font.addGlyph(1, -1, 600, null, null);
font.addGlyph(1, 100, 600, null, null);
Assertions.assertEquals(1, font.getNumberOfGlyphs());
Assertions.assertEquals(1, font.getGlyph(100).getCode());
Assertions.assertEquals(100, font.getGlyphByCode(1).getUnicode());
}
@Test
public void replaceGlyphWithSameCodeEmptyUnicodeLastTest() {
Type3Font font = new Type3Font(false);
font.addGlyph(1, 100, 600, null, null);
font.addGlyph(1, -1, 600, null, null);
Assertions.assertNull(font.getGlyph(-1));
Assertions.assertNull(font.getGlyph(100));
Assertions.assertEquals(1, font.getNumberOfGlyphs());
Assertions.assertEquals(-1, font.getGlyphByCode(1).getUnicode());
}
}
